What companies run services between Ullapool, Scotland and Lerwick, Scotland?
There is no direct connection from Ullapool to Lerwick. However, you can take the bus to Bus Station Stance 6, walk to Inverness, take the train to Inverness Airport, walk to Inverness Airport station, take the bus to Terminal Building, walk to Inverness Dalcross Airport (INV) airport, fly to Lerwick (LSI), walk to Terminal, then take the bus to Harrison Square. Alternatively, you can take a bus from High School to Lerwick Shetland Holmsgarth Ferry Terminal via Bus Station Stance 6, Inverness, Aberdeen, and Aberdeen Ferry Terminal in around 20h 52m.
